マウスのバグ

リタイアした場所

マイクロマウス九州大会でリタイアしたマイクロマウスのバグを調査すべくPython + Tkinterでシミュレーションプログラムを作っていたのだが、やっと原因がわかった。経路生成ルーチンが閉路に対応しておらず、閉路が出現すると無限ループに陥るようになっていた。まぁ、マウスの迷路に閉路があることも知らなかったし、仕方ないか。

さて、あらたな経路生成ルーチンはどう作ろう。今度は事前に十分にテストして問題の無い物にしたい。

Leave a Reply

メールアドレスが公開されることはありません。